Understanding ADHD and the Need for Diagnosis
ADHD is characterized by a consistent pattern of negligence and/or hyperactivity-impulsivity that interferes with working or development. Although the precise causes remain unclear, genes, environment, and brain structure are believed to contribute.
Importance of Diagnosis
An official diagnosis of ADHD can lead the way for reliable management and support methods. It is important for:

The journey generally starts with a preliminary consultation with a certified health care specialist, such as a psychiatrist or psychologist. This conference aims to discuss symptoms, medical history, and any previous assessments.
Action 2: Comprehensive Assessment
During the assessment stage, practitioners will carry out:
Clinical interviews: Discussing history and behaviourStandardized score scales: Utilized to evaluate symptom seriousnessObservational assessments: Noting behaviour in different settingsAction 3: Feedback Session
After the assessments are finished, a feedback session is arranged. Here, the doctor will talk about the results, use the diagnosis (if appropriate), and recommend management strategies.
Step 4: Follow-Up Care
Post-diagnosis, people can benefit from follow-up visits to keep an eye on progress and make any required changes to treatment.

Just how much does a private ADHD diagnosis cost?
The cost for a private ADHD diagnosis can differ widely, ranging from ₤ 300 to ₤ 1,500 depending upon the level of the assessments, area, and specific services provided.
2. For how long does the assessment take?
The assessment usually lasts from one to 3 hours, depending on the person's needs and the specific tests administered. Follow-up sessions might likewise be essential.
3. Is a private diagnosis legitimate?
Yes, a valid diagnosis from a licensed expert is recognized by health care systems and instructional institutions. Lastly, it's essential to ensure the professional is licensed and follows standardized assessment protocols.
4. Can I receive treatment from the same provider?
Many private diagnosis centers also provide treatment services, consisting of medication management, treatment, and support system. It's a good idea to ask throughout the preliminary consultation.
5. Can I get support if I have a private diagnosis?
Definitely. Numerous organizations and regional support system provide resources and details for people diagnosed with ADHD, no matter whether the diagnosis was made openly or privately.
